首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Github操作VM和本地中的不同gradle输出

在Github操作VM和本地中,gradle输出可能存在一些差异。下面我将详细解释这些差异以及可能的原因。

  1. 差异解释: 在Github操作VM中,gradle输出可能与本地环境中的输出不同,这主要是由于以下几个方面的差异导致的:
    • 系统环境:Github操作VM使用的操作系统环境可能与本地环境不同,例如操作系统版本、文件系统类型等,这可能会导致一些系统相关的差异。
    • 依赖管理:Github操作VM中使用的依赖管理工具可能与本地环境中的不同,例如使用不同的版本管理工具、依赖库的版本不同等,这可能会导致一些依赖相关的差异。
    • 网络环境:Github操作VM中的网络环境可能与本地环境不同,例如网络延迟、网络带宽等,这可能会导致一些网络相关的差异。
  • 可能的原因: 下面列举了一些可能导致Github操作VM和本地中gradle输出差异的原因:
    • 系统环境差异:Github操作VM使用的操作系统版本可能与本地环境不同,例如Github操作VM使用的是Linux系统,而本地环境使用的是Windows系统,这可能导致一些系统命令的差异,进而影响gradle的输出。
    • 依赖版本差异:Github操作VM中使用的gradle版本可能与本地环境中的版本不同,不同版本的gradle可能会有一些功能上的差异,从而导致输出结果不同。
    • 网络环境差异:Github操作VM中的网络环境可能与本地环境不同,例如Github操作VM中的网络延迟可能较高,这可能会导致一些网络请求超时或失败,进而影响gradle的输出。
  • 解决方法: 如果需要在Github操作VM和本地中保持一致的gradle输出,可以考虑以下解决方法:
    • 确保系统环境一致:尽量在Github操作VM和本地环境中使用相同的操作系统版本和配置,这样可以减少系统环境带来的差异。
    • 统一依赖版本:在项目中明确指定依赖库的版本,避免依赖库版本不一致导致的输出差异。
    • 模拟网络环境:在本地环境中模拟Github操作VM中的网络环境,例如使用网络模拟工具模拟高延迟或低带宽的网络环境,以便更好地调试和排查网络相关的问题。
  • 相关产品和链接: 腾讯云提供了一系列与云计算相关的产品,以下是一些推荐的产品和产品介绍链接地址:
    • 云服务器(CVM):提供弹性、安全、可靠的云服务器实例,适用于各种应用场景。产品介绍链接
    • 云数据库MySQL版:提供高性能、可扩展的云数据库服务,适用于各种规模的应用。产品介绍链接
    • 云原生容器服务:提供高可用、弹性伸缩的容器化应用部署和管理服务。产品介绍链接
    • 云存储COS:提供安全、可靠、低成本的对象存储服务,适用于各种数据存储需求。产品介绍链接

请注意,以上链接仅供参考,具体产品选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

领券